Damien George
da4593f937
tools/ci.sh: Use IDF v4.4 as part of esp32 CI and build GENERIC_S3.
...
IDF v4.4 does not have an official release so for now use the latest
master. Also remove building GENERIC with no options (all the other boards
are no-option builds), to keep CI time reasonable.
Signed-off-by: Damien George <damien@micropython.org>
2021-09-16 22:59:05 +10:00
Damien George
a9bbf7083e
tools/ci.sh: Build esp32 using IDF v4.0.2 and v4.3.
...
To test different IDF's, and also test building the GENERIC_S2 board.
Signed-off-by: Damien George <damien@micropython.org>
2021-04-15 10:31:06 +10:00
Damien George
aa3d6b6aa5
tools/ci.sh: Change esp32 CI to work with idf.py and IDF v4.0.2.
...
Signed-off-by: Damien George <damien@micropython.org>
2021-02-15 16:40:11 +11:00
Damien George
69262a11dc
tools/ci.sh: Put echo of CI path in a separate function.
...
Because the setup functions may print other information which should not be
added to the path.
Signed-off-by: Damien George <damien@micropython.org>
2020-12-14 13:05:43 +11:00
Damien George
a598ae5b4d
github/workflows: Add workflows for all CI tasks, builds and tests.
...
Signed-off-by: Damien George <damien@micropython.org>
2020-11-29 22:21:28 +11:00